Ticket: TIMETBL-412 — sign-off needed before we ship the Hollowby timetable solver update. Quick summary: we swapped the constraint engine and it now reads teacher availability from the shared roster service, so there's a new cross-service auth path to eyeball. No student PII leaves the solver, but please double-check the roster token scoping. Once you're happy, grab sign-off from the owner named below.

account owner for bawip-tahag: Raleth Quenok

Ticket: Log sampling drift on the Pindlewick notifier. The service is emitting full-volume logs again in the Corvel region, which suggests the sampling config was reverted during last week's redeploy. Please do not silence the logger manually; that hides genuine errors. Restore sampling via the deploy pipeline and confirm volume drops within an hour. The intended configuration values appear below.

config for bagep-kageg:
ULADOR_LOG_LEVEL=warn
ULADOR_METRICS_HOST=metrics.ulador.tolvaqcorp.corp
ULADOR_POOL_SIZE=32

**Q: Why does LiftSim's dispatch queue use a custom heap instead of the standard library?**

The stdlib heap reorders equal-priority hall calls, which breaks determinism in replay tests. Our heap is insertion-stable. Don't "simplify" it during review — the replay suite will fail silently on some seeds. See `docs/determinism.md` for the full rationale. Questions about the heap invariants go to the sim-core maintainer.

escalation mailbox, hahog-yahop: wenox.ralix.ralax@qirvandata.local

**Ticket: Pricing experiment config drifted on Ferngate**

Future maintainers, hi. The ticket-pricing experiment on Ferngate (the dynamic discount thing Marla set up last quarter) has drifted between staging and prod. Staging is still running the 15% weekend bucket while prod quietly reverted to flat pricing after a bad rollback. Results from the last two weeks are basically junk — flag them in the dashboard. Before re-launching, reconcile everything against the source of truth. The intended values are as follows.

service settings:
novath:
  pin: 1396
  tenant: pelys
  seal: seal_ccc035e1
  metrics_host: metrics.novath.qorvelworks.test
  standby_team: fraeth
  escalation: drueth-zorok
  nonce: 61d508